This summer Dechen Choling will continue our popular new leadership program for teenagers and young adults (ages 15-25).

The idea for this program came from the hope to fulfill 2 different requests we hear again and again- to offer more engaging childcare for all of the programs, and to provide opportunities for teenagers and young adults to spend time at DCL during the summer months. Therefore, the program consists of three parts:
1. Leadership training- Shambhala has a wealth of teachings on how to be a genuine and effective leader. We are also fortunate to have many senior students who, for many years, have been putting these teaching into practice in their personal and professional lives. There will be regular discussion groups and talks by senior students and visiting teachers.
2. Mentorship- To put these teachings into action, the participants will also be in charge of childcare and will act as mentors/caretakers to the younger children on the land. This is a very important job, not only is there responsibility for the well-being and education of children of different ages, but also being a liaison between parents and staff. Mentors will lead children in fun activities, art projects and even meditation!
3. Sangha (community)- Everyone who participates in this program will be a part of a close group who live, learn, and work together. There will be plenty of time to socialize with new and old friends, and participate in the various summer activities and events at Dechen Chöling.
It is our hope that participants will walk away with unique wisdom, work experience and memories of a summer of friends, practice, and fun.
